The twosamp class is returned by the functions bpcp2samp or delta2samp. The class
represents the comparison of two survival curves at each observed event time.
Unlike the htest class, which compares curves at specified testtimes,
the twosamp class compares curves at all observed event times.
Objects of this class has methods for the functions summary and plot.
